Recently, about a month ago, i've got myself a second hand Minolta
DiMAGE Scan Elite II (2820DPI+ICE). Everything was just perfect, scans
are great and all that. I was just happy !
Once the year changed (2005->2006) something in my computer has gone
completely MAD ! I didn't change nothing nor in photoshop nor in the
scanner software (i use the Minolta one, the original, downloaded from
the site). Now, i can't open any TIFF image scanned in my photoshop :(
Any other image viewer (like IrfanView and ACDSee) works just fine
with those files, but not the PS CS2 :( I've tried to reinstall the
driver and the software - no help.. Photoshop just keep screaming with
"Could not complete your request because of the program error"
message... I've tried to scan a JPG and it works just fine but not the
TIFF.
I've NEVER seen this before. I've researched the internet today all
day and found absolutely nothing ! Did anyone see this behaviour ?
